Ski for Free at Monarch in Exchange for Non-Perishable Food or Cash Donation

Monarch Mountain Official Instagram Photo.

Monarch Mountain in Chaffee County, Colorado is continuing the spirit of giving with their latest announcement. On December 9, any skiers or snowboarders who give non-perishable food or make a cash donation receive a free lift ticket for the day. Monarch’s goal is to celebrate their community by giving back. All food donations will go to the Salida’s Grainery and 1st Presbyterian Church food banks. Cash donations will benefit the Boys and Girls Clubs of Chaffee County.

Last year Monarch collected nearly 8,000 pounds of food and more than $2,000 in cash for the Boys and Girls Club. While it’s Monarch’s 80th anniversary, the mountain hopes to continue this tradition and celebrate its local community every year.
